About The Position

Under the supervision of the Operations Supervisor and as an integral part of a maintenance team, the technician will be responsible for carrying out vibration and predictive monitoring, analyzing data and drawing up reports and recommendations. They will be interacting on a regular basis with our customers to help them avoid unplanned shutdowns.

Responsibilities

  • Perform vibration, thermographic and ultrasonic measurements on industrial equipment.
  • Perform oil collections for condition analysis.
  • Perform data analysis using software and document the results.
  • Develop reports and make technical recommendations and interact with clients.
  • Perform precision corrective work including dynamic balancing, laser and geometric alignment in industrial plants.
  • Work on implementation programs and improvement of plant reliability (lubrication program and optimization of preventive maintenance).
